本文目录导读:
随着互联网的飞速发展,服务器并发数成为了衡量服务器性能的重要指标之一,高并发意味着服务器能够同时处理大量请求,从而提高用户体验,如何有效提高服务器并发数,成为了众多企业关注的焦点,本文将从服务器并发数的概念、影响因素、优化策略等方面进行深入探讨。
服务器并发数的概念
服务器并发数是指服务器在同一时刻能够处理的最大请求数量,它反映了服务器的处理能力和承载能力,服务器并发数越高,其性能越好。
影响服务器并发数的因素
1、硬件因素
(1)CPU:CPU是服务器并发处理的核心,其性能直接影响并发数,高性能的CPU能够提供更高的并发处理能力。
图片来源于网络,如有侵权联系删除
(2)内存:内存容量越大,服务器可以存储更多的数据,从而提高并发处理能力。
(3)硬盘:硬盘读写速度越快,服务器处理请求的效率越高,进而提高并发数。
2、软件因素
(1)操作系统:不同的操作系统对并发处理的支持程度不同,选择合适的操作系统对提高并发数至关重要。
(2)数据库:数据库性能直接影响并发数,优化数据库索引、查询等,可以提高并发处理能力。
(3)应用程序:应用程序的设计与实现也对并发数产生影响,合理设计程序,提高代码执行效率,有助于提高并发数。
3、网络因素
(1)带宽:带宽越高,服务器处理请求的速度越快,从而提高并发数。
(2)网络延迟:网络延迟越低,服务器处理请求的时间越短,有利于提高并发数。
图片来源于网络,如有侵权联系删除
提高服务器并发数的优化策略
1、硬件优化
(1)升级CPU:根据实际需求,选择高性能的CPU,提高并发处理能力。
(2)增加内存:提高内存容量,减少内存访问冲突,提高并发处理能力。
(3)升级硬盘:选择高速硬盘,提高数据读写速度,从而提高并发数。
2、软件优化
(1)操作系统优化:根据实际需求,选择合适的操作系统,并对其进行优化,提高并发处理能力。
(2)数据库优化:优化数据库索引、查询等,提高数据库性能,从而提高并发数。
(3)应用程序优化:优化程序设计,提高代码执行效率,降低资源消耗,从而提高并发数。
3、网络优化
图片来源于网络,如有侵权联系删除
(1)提高带宽:根据实际需求,升级网络带宽,提高服务器处理请求的速度。
(2)降低网络延迟:优化网络配置,降低网络延迟,提高并发处理能力。
4、分布式架构
采用分布式架构,将请求分散到多个服务器上,提高并发处理能力。
5、缓存技术
利用缓存技术,减少数据库访问次数,提高并发处理能力。
服务器并发数是衡量服务器性能的重要指标,通过优化硬件、软件、网络等方面,可以有效提高服务器并发数,从而提高用户体验,在实际应用中,应根据具体情况,选择合适的优化策略,以达到最佳效果。
标签: #服务器并发数
评论列表